Mos, the town of Oscar Pereiro, will host the start of the 18th stage. According to the local newspaper, it will be one of three stages in Galicia. Given that Mos is located in the southwest corner of Galicia, I guess it will be the final Galician stage (to Luintra), with a flat stage 19 and stage 20 in the mountains in Salamanca province. The real question is what the third Galician stage will be, perhaps Ancares is in the route after all, if there actually is a third Galician stage (doesn't fit extremely well).
The second week will have a flat stage from either Miranda de Ebro or Castrillo del Val to Aguilar de Campoo. The stage should be between the Valdegovia and Suances stages. With stages 16 to 18 seemingly in Galicia, it will probably be either stage 11 or 12.
The route should be something like the one below. It's possible that Laguna Negra is stage 6, Moncalvillo is stage 10 (in which case, move the following stages one ahead) and either La Camperona or the first Galician stage is out.
Week 1
Stage 4 Irun - Arrate (MTF with Karakate and Arrate)
Stage 5 Pamplona - Lekunberri (mountain with San Miguel de Aralar)
Stage 6 Logroño - Moncalvillo OR Laguna Negra de Urbion (MTF)
Stage 7 Soria - Ejea de los Caballeros (flat)
Stage 8 Huesca - somewhere in the Pyrenees around Jaca or Sabiñanigo (easy mountain stage, possibly MTF)
Stage 9 Jaca, Sabiñanigo OR Biescas - Tourmalet (MTF with at least either Somport or Portalet, then Aubisque and Tourmalet)
Rest day
Stage 10 Vitoria-Gasteiz - Valdegovia (mid-mountain with Orduña)
Stage 11 Miranda de Ebro OR Castrillo del Val - Aguilar de Campoo (flat)
Stage 12 Castro Urdiales - Suances (flat or mid-mountain)
Stage 13 Somewhere in Cantabria - La Camperona (MTF)
Stage 14 Cistierna? - Angliru (MTF, should have at least two cat. 1's before Angliru)
Stage 15 ? - La Farrapona (MTF, probably through San Lorenzo)
Rest day
Stage 16 (could also be before the restday): Somewhere in Galicia, either Ancares or something (much) easier.
Stage 17 Muros - Mirador de Ézaro (ITT with HTF)
Stage 18 Mos - Luintra-Ribeira Sacra (mid-mountain, should be the same finale as 2016 and 2018)
Stage 19 Somewhere in Zamora - Ciudad Rodrigo or somewhere else in Salamanca (flat)
Stage 20 Ciudad Rodrigo or somewhere else in Salamanca - La Covatilla or somewhere nearby-ish (mountain)
Stage 21 Madrid parade (flat)
